What is Embrace Zouk Online and how did it come to be?

In 2019, after teaching many workshops about close embrace in Brazilian Zouk, Kelsey and I realized there were not many options for people to learn more about it and what movements could be created from it. Being two people that love dancing in this position, we developed the desire to show people the versatility and the amazingness of dancing in an endless close embrace! We wanted to show how soothing for the body and how beautifully complex “simple” could be.


With that in mind, we created the Embrace Zouk Weekender. A 12-hour dance learning marathon, with two different levels and a lot of content, showing the foundations of dancing comfortably in close embrace and all the crazy, fun things we can do.

In 2020, we were ready and excited to take this workshop around the country. But then...you know...COVID. After a few days feeling super bummed about everything that was put on hold, we saw an opportunity to take this workshop to a broader audience and spread the message of dancing in close embrace everywhere.


Without any hesitation, we created this Embrace Zouk Online course, which contains all of what we teach in our Embrace Zouk Weekender, plus a couple things that we created more recently.
